An Employee Assistance Program is a program designed to identify and assist employees, through a variety of services, in resolving personal problems (e.g., marital, financial or emotional problems; family issues; substance/alcohol abuse) that may be adversely affecting the employee’s performance.
Services may include:
- Counseling Services Face-to-face assessment
- Short term counseling
- Referral and follow-up for alcohol and drug problems
- Work related difficulties
- Marriage and family issues
- Emotional and psychological problems
- Counseling offices located conveniently to your employees
- 24 hours per day, 7 days per week, toll-free telephone access to mental health professionals
- Case management that includes coordinating referrals to resources beyond the EAP, when needed
